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Garve to Merryton start from as little as £41.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Garve to Merryton are available for £99.60 one way, or £139.50 return

Facilities at Garve Station: What to Expect

Garve Station is a simple yet charming spot that captures the serene atmosphere of the highlands. The station operates without a ticket office or ticket machines, so it's vital for travelers to purchase tickets online in advance, as there are also no facilities for collecting pre-booked tickets on-site.

While you won't find an abundance of modern conveniences like Wi-Fi or waiting rooms, there are basic amenities to ensure a comfortable visit. With a seating area provided, travelers can relax while they await their train. Although there are no first-class lounges, induction loops are available for those needing auditory assistance.

For travelers with mobility needs, it’s noteworthy that Garve Station offers some level access, yet not complete step-free access, so planning ahead is advisable. There are customer help points, but no dedicated staff available, making it crucial to prepare adequately before your journey.

There’s provision for bike storage at the station, with six spaces available, although currently, there are no hired bicycle facilities on-site. Car parking is free and accessible 24/7 with a modest availability of ten spaces.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Merryton is a station that emphasizes simplicity. While it lacks a ticket office or machines for purchasing tickets, the station is fully accessible with step-free access throughout. The presence of smartcard validators makes it easier for modern travelers carrying smartcards. Despite the absence of staff, passengers can receive up-to-date departure information through screens and announcements. You'll also find customer help points available. CCTV cameras enhance safety throughout the location, reassuring travelers during their visits.
